Lập trình đơn giản

NH

Bài 1: hãy chỉ ra lỗi sai và sửa lại?

Program thu-nghiem

uses crt;

write (`Xin chao cac ban`);

write (`Hay hoc hanh cham chi`);

readln

end

Bài 2 Hãy cho biết giá trị của y bằng bao nhiêu? giải thích?

var x: integer;

y: real;

begin

x:=225 div 9;

y:=(4+8*(9-5))/2-((4-5)^2+6)*15/5;

y:=y-x;

y:=x/y;

readln

end.

Bài 3 Hãy cho biết giá trị của x bằng bao nhiêu? Giải thích?

var y:integer;

x:=real;

begin

x:=(8*4+(5-3))*(9+6)/(3*2-4)

y:=18 mod 5;

x:=x*y;

x:=x-y:

readln

end.

VD
26 tháng 9 2017 lúc 20:27

Program thu-nghiem

uses crt;

write (`Xin chao cac ban`);

write (`Hay hoc hanh cham chi`);

readln

end

Sửa:

Program thunghiem;

uses crt;

writeln (`Xin chao cac ban`);

writeln (`Hay hoc hanh cham chi`);

readln;

end.

Bình luận (0)
VD
26 tháng 9 2017 lúc 20:28

Góp ý nha!

Bình luận (0)
HQ
3 tháng 10 2017 lúc 20:14

Bài 1: hãy chỉ ra lỗi sai và sửa lại?

-> lỗi sai:
+Tên chương trình phần program thiếu ';' và sai tên vì có ký tự '-' -> sửa lại thành Program thu_nghiem;
+2 dòng write(....); -> bạn thêm dấu nháy đơn vào 2 đầu của dòng chữ -> write('Ξnchaocacban'); và write ('Hayhochanhchamχ');
+end có dấu '.' -> end.


Bài 2:
Y bằng -25/28
vì X=225/9=25; Y=(4+8*(9-5))/2-((4-5)^2+6)*15/5= -3
y= y-x = -3 - 25 = -28
x = x/y = 25/-28 = -25/28

Bài 3:
X=762
Vì x=(8*4+(5-3))*(9+6)/(3*2-4)=255; y = 18 mod 5 = 3;
x= x * y = 255 *3 = 765; x = x - y = 765 - 3 = 762

Bình luận (0)

Các câu hỏi tương tự
NG
Xem chi tiết
HT
Xem chi tiết
PH
Xem chi tiết
NN
Xem chi tiết
NN
Xem chi tiết
PT
Xem chi tiết
NA
Xem chi tiết
DV
Xem chi tiết
DL
Xem chi tiết